 USER MANUAL    ETHSU – EASYFIT TEMPERATURE AND HUMIDITY SENSOR  © 2017 EnOcean  |  www.enocean.com   F-710-017, V1.0        ETHSU User Manual  | v1.0 | December 2017 |  Page 5/14  2 GENERAL DESCRIPTION   2.1 Basic functionality   EnOcean  EasyFit  ETHSU  is  a  wireless  and  maintenance free  temperature  and  humidity  sensor.  It  requires  no external  components  and provides  on-board a  calibrat-ed temperature and humidity sensor.   Power  supply is  provided by  a  small  pre-installed  solar cell or an external 3 V backup battery.   An  energy  storage  element  is  installed  in  order  to bridge periods with no supply from the energy harvest-er.   The  module  provides  an  internal  cyclic  wake  up  every 100s. After wake up, the internal microcontroller reads the  status  of  the  temperature  and  humidity  sensor.  A radio  telegram  will  be  transmitted  in  case  of  a  signifi-cant  change of  measured  temperature  or  measure  hu-midity.   In case of no relevant input change, a redundant retransmission signal (heartbeat) is sent randomly within 8 to 15 minutes to announce the current values.   In addition to the cyclic wake-up, a wake up can be triggered externally using the input for the occupancy button or the internal LRN button.   Key product features    Fully autonomous operation under sufficient lighting with pre-installed solar cell   Factory calibrated on-board temperature and humidity sensor   Integrated energy storage and charging circuit   Integrated LRN button and TX indicator LED
 USER MANUAL    ETHSU – EASYFIT TEMPERATURE AND HUMIDITY SENSOR  © 2017 EnOcean  |  www.enocean.com   F-710-017, V1.0        ETHSU User Manual  | v1.0 | December 2017 |  Page 6/14  2.2 Technical Data  Antenna Helix antenna Frequency  902.875 MHz Data rate/Modulation type 125 kbps / FSK Radiated Output Power (typ.) 100 dBμV/m On-board Power Supply  Pre-installed solar cell Illumination 50-100000 lux Auxiliary Power Supply  Option for backup battery (CR1225) Operation time in darkness @ 25°C  typ. 4 days after full charge Start-up time from empty energy store  typ. < 5 min @ 400 lux / 25 °C                                                                                                  incandescent or fluorescent light Input parameters Temperature and humidity sensor LRN button Temperature sensor performance Measurement range:    -20°C … +60 °C               Resolution:     0.1 K                  Accuracy:  ±0.5 K across entire range Humidity sensor performance Measurement range:  0 % r.h. … 100 % r.h.               Resolution:   0.4 % r.h.                       Accuracy:  ±4.5 % r.h. across entire range        ±3.0 % r.h. between 20 … 80 % r.h. EnOcean Equipment Profile                       A5-04-03    2.3 Environmental conditions  Operating and Storage temperature                                  Absolute Maximum: -20 °C … +60 °C                                                                                                  Recommended1: +10 °C…+30 °C Shelf life (in absolute darkness) 36 months after delivery2 Operating and storage humidity Maximum: 0% … 93% r.h., non-condensing                                                                                                             Recommended: < 60% r.h.   2.4 Ordering Information  Type Ordering Code Frequency ETHSU S3051-D350 902.875MHz                                             1 Recommended for maximum life of energy storage capacitor 2  Deep  discharge  of  the  energy  storage  leads  to  degradation  of  performance.  Therefore products have to be taken into operation after 36 months.   The module shall not be  placed  on  conductive materials, to prevent  discharge of the  internal  energy  storages.  Even  materials  such as  conductive foam (ESD pro-tection) may have negative impact.

 USER MANUAL    ETHSU – EASYFIT TEMPERATURE AND HUMIDITY SENSOR  © 2017 EnOcean  |  www.enocean.com   F-710-017, V1.0        ETHSU User Manual  | v1.0 | December 2017 |  Page 9/14  3.2 Simplified device block diagram       3.3 Radio telegram format  ETHSU  transmits  telegram  data  according  to  EEP  (EnOcean  Equipment  Profile)  A5-04-03 which encodes a temperature range of Temperature -20 ... 60°C with 10 Bit and a Humidity range of 0 ... 100 % r.h.  with 8 Bit.  3.3.1 Teach-in telegram If the user presses the LRN button then the module transmits a teach-in telegram.   With  this  special  teach-in  telegram  it  is  possible  to  identify  the  manufacturer  of  a  device and the function and type of a device via the EEP or GP used.   By default EnOcean Manufacturer ID is set. Customers should configure the module to use their own Manufacturer ID.    3.3.2 Transmit timing  The setup of the transmission timing allows avoiding possible collisions with data packages of other EnOcean transmitters as well as disturbances from the environment.   With  each  default  transmission  cycle,  3  identical  sub-telegrams  are  transmitted  within 40ms. Transmission  of a sub-telegram lasts  approximately  1.2ms. The delay between the three transmission bursts is affected at random.
 USER MANUAL    ETHSU – EASYFIT TEMPERATURE AND HUMIDITY SENSOR  © 2017 EnOcean  |  www.enocean.com   F-710-017, V1.0        ETHSU User Manual  | v1.0 | December 2017 |  Page 10/14  4 Application Information  4.1 Transmission range  The main factors that influence the system transmission range are type and location of the antennas of the receiver and the transmitter, type of terrain and degree of obstruction of the  link  path,  sources  of  interference  affecting  the  receiver,  and  “Dead”  spots  caused  by signal  reflections  from  nearby  conductive  objects.  Since  the  expected  transmission  range strongly depends on this system conditions, range tests should categorically be performed before notification of a particular range that will be attainable by a certain application. The following figures for expected transmission range may be used as a rough guide only:   Line-of-sight connections: Typically 30 m range in corridors, up to 100 m in halls   Plasterboard walls / dry wood: Typically 30 m range, through max. 5 walls   Ferroconcrete walls / ceilings: Typically 10 m range, through max. 1 ceiling   Fire-safety walls, elevator shafts, staircases and supply areas should be considered as screening.  The angle at which the transmitted signal hits the wall is very important. The effective wall thickness  –  and  with  it  the  signal  attenuation  –  varies  according  to  this  angle.  Signals should be transmitted as directly as possible through the wall. Wall niches should be avoid-ed. Other factors restricting transmission range:   Switch mounted on metal surfaces (up to 30% loss of transmission range)   Hollow lightweight walls filled with insulating wool on metal foil   False ceilings with panels of metal or carbon fiber   Lead glass or glass with metal coating, steel furniture The distance  between  EnOcean receivers and  other  transmitting  devices such  as  comput-ers,  audio  and  video  equipment  that  also  emit  high-frequency  signals  should  be  at  least 0.5 m.
